Statement of Cash Flows
This document details the combined amount of cash a business gains from its day-to-day operations and outside investments, and the cash it expends on operating and investing activities over a particular period.
Indirect Method
A method of calculating cash flows from operating activities in the cash flow statement by adjusting net income for changes in non-cash accounts.
Investing Activities
Transactions involving the purchase and sale of long-term assets and other investments not considered cash equivalents.
